  • Patent number: 7507181
    Abstract: A method and device for determining a driving torque correction factor for compensating the driving torques of a drive unit including a first drive device and a second drive device, both of which act with their driving torque on a common drive shaft. The method includes specifying and setting a desired driving torque for one of the two drive devices, adjusting a brake torque for the other of the two drive devices to a brake torque value, which is equivalent to the value of the actual driving torque (that occurs on the basis of the desired driving torque) of one of the two drive devices, and determining the correction value as a function of the specified desired driving torque of the one drive device and as a function of the brake torque value of the other drive device, the brake torque value being adjusted at the time of the compensation of the torques.
    Type: Grant
    Filed: May 15, 2008
    Date of Patent: March 24, 2009
    Assignee: Bayerische Motoren Werke Aktiengesellschaft
    Inventors: Marcel Fenkart, Juergen Gebert, Oliver Grohe, Stephan Peuckmann, Stefan Schinagl

  • Patent number: 7258646
    Abstract: Differential gearing for vehicles, having a gearing input and two gearing output shafts which exit on mutually opposite sides of a differential gearing housing from the differential gearing housing, having a differential holder which is arranged in the differential gearing housing in the area between the gearing output shafts, the differential holder being rotatably disposed in the differential gearing housing by means of a ball bearing arrangement which has a bearing prestress. At least one disk spring is provided which generates the bearing prestress of the ball bearing arrangement.
    Type: Grant
    Filed: February 22, 2006
    Date of Patent: August 21, 2007
    Assignee: Bayerische Motoren Werke Aktiengesellschafy
    Inventors: Hans Rastel, Stefan Schinagl, Frank Gielisch, Wolfgang Steinberger
